Checksums in Program Distribution: When application is dispersed by way of down load, MD5 checksums are frequently furnished to verify the downloaded file matches the first file and it has not been tampered with. Nonetheless, as a consequence of MD5’s collision vulnerabilities, more secure hash features like SHA-256 are getting used instead of MD